Understanding Skin Tones and Undertones
Before we talk about the best colors, it helps to know a little bit about skin. Your skin tone is how light or dark your skin is. Your undertone is the color underneath your skin. There are three main undertones:
- Warm: Your skin has a yellow or golden color.
- Cool: Your skin has a pink or blue color.
- Neutral: Your skin has a mix of warm and cool colors.
The best universal lipstick shades have a good balance of warm and cool colors in them. This is why they look good on everyone.
The Universal Lipstick Colors You Need
These are the lipstick shades that every person should have in their makeup bag. They are safe choices that always look good.
1. The Perfect Nude
A nude lipstick is a color that is close to your natural lip color but a little better. A lot of people have a hard time finding a good nude because if it’s too light, it can make you look tired.
The Universal Nude: A soft, rosy brown. This color is not too light and not too dark. The mix of pink and brown means it doesn’t look gray or ashy on light skin and doesn’t disappear on deep skin. It just makes your lips look fuller and more natural.
- Why it works: The touch of pink makes it look lively, and the brown makes it match different skin tones. It’s a color that is simple and elegant.
2. The Berry Pink
Pink can be hard to wear. Some pinks are too bright or too light. But a berry pink is special. It’s a pink that has a little bit of blue and a little bit of purple in it.
The Universal Berry: A deep, dusty rose or a soft berry shade. This color is a mix of pink, red, and a little purple. It looks good on light skin because it is not too bright. It looks good on medium and deep skin because it is a rich, beautiful color that stands out.
- Why it works: The mix of colors means it looks natural and pretty on everyone. It is a color you can wear every day or for a special event.
3. The Classic Red
Red lipstick is a timeless choice. It is bold and makes a statement. But red lipstick can be very hard to get right.
The Universal Red: A red with a blue undertone. This means the red has a little bit of a bluish color in it. It might look a little pink or purple in the tube, but on your lips, it just looks like a beautiful, true red.
- Why it works: A red with a blue undertone makes teeth look whiter, which is a big plus. It looks bright on light skin and adds a pop of color to deep skin. It is the kind of red that looks good in every photo.
4. The Deep Plum
A deep lipstick color can look very chic. A deep plum or a color like wine is a great option. But some of these colors can be very dark.
The Universal Plum: A plum color that is not too dark and has a hint of berry in it. It is a color that looks like a mix of purple and red.
- Why it works: On light skin, this color looks very bold and pretty. On deep skin, it looks natural and deep. It is a color that adds a touch of drama to any look without being too much. It is perfect for a night out.
Tips for Wearing Any Lipstick
Once you find the right color, here are a few tips to make your lipstick look even better.
Prepare Your Lips
- Exfoliate: Use a lip scrub to gently rub off any dry skin. This makes your lips smooth so the lipstick goes on evenly. You can even make your own scrub with sugar and honey.
- Moisturize: Put on a lip balm a few minutes before you put on your lipstick. This keeps your lips soft and hydrated.
Use a Lip Liner
A lip liner is a pencil that is the same color as your lipstick. It helps to define your lips and keeps the lipstick from moving outside the lines. Use the liner to fill in your whole lip. This makes the lipstick last longer.
Blot Your Lips
After you put on your lipstick, press a tissue between your lips. This takes off any extra lipstick and helps the color stay on your lips, not on your teeth.
